Introduce new progress (base) classes in apt_pkg:
- apt_pkg.AcquireProgress
- apt_pkg.OpProgress

diff --git a/python/acquireprogress.cc b/python/acquireprogress.cc new file mode 100644 index 00000000..ac3b8fd9 --- /dev/null +++ b/python/acquireprogress.cc @@ -0,0 +1,198 @@ +/* acquireprogress.cc - Base class for FetchProgress classes. + * + * Copyright 2009 Julian Andres Klode <jak@debian.org> + * + * This program is free software; you can redistribute it and/or modify + * it under the terms of the GNU General Public License as published by + * the Free Software Foundation; either version 2 of the License, or + * (at your option) any later version. + * + * This program is distributed in the hope that it will be useful, + * but WITHOUT ANY WARRANTY; without even the implied warranty of + * MERCHANTABILITY or F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E. See the + * GNU General Public License for more details. + * + * You should have received a copy of the GNU General Public License + * along with this program; if not, write to the Free Software + * Foundation, Inc., 51 Franklin Street, Fifth Floor, Boston, + * MA 02110-1301, USA. + */ + +#include "generic.h" +#include <Python.h> +#include <structmember.h> + +typedef struct { + PyObject_HEAD + double last_bytes; + double current_cps; + double current_bytes; + double total_bytes; + double fetched_bytes; + unsigned long elapsed_time; + unsigned long total_items; + unsigned long current_items; +} PyAcquireProgressObject; + + +// DUMMY IMPLEMENTATIONS. +static char *acquireprogress_media_change_doc = + "media_change(media: str, drive: str) -> bool\n\n" + "Invoked when the user should be prompted to change the inserted\n" + "removable media.\n\n" + "This method should not return until the user has confirmed to the user\n" + "interface that the media change is complete.\n\n" + ":param:media The name of the media type that should be changed.\n" + ":param:drive The identifying name of the drive whose media should be\n" + " changed.\n\n" + "Return True if the user confirms the media change, False if it is\n" + "cancelled."; +static PyObject *acquireprogress_media_change(PyObject *self, PyObject *args) +{ + Py_RETURN_FALSE; +} + +static char *acquireprogress_ims_hit_doc = "ims_hit(item: AcquireItemDesc)\n\n" + "Invoked when an item is confirmed to be up-to-date. For instance,\n" + "when an HTTP download is informed that the file on the server was\n" + "not modified."; +static PyObject *acquireprogress_ims_hit(PyObject *self, PyObject *arg) +{ + // TODO: Add type check. + Py_RETURN_NONE; +} + +static char *acquireprogress_fetch_doc = "fetch(item: AcquireItemDesc)\n\n" + "Invoked when some of an item's data is fetched."; +static PyObject *acquireprogress_fetch(PyObject *self, PyObject *args) +{ + // TODO: Add type check. + Py_RETURN_NONE; +} + +static char *acquireprogress_done_doc = "done(item: AcquireItemDesc)\n\n" + "Invoked when an item is successfully and completely fetched."; +static PyObject *acquireprogress_done(PyObject *self, PyObject *args) +{ + // TODO: Add type check. + Py_RETURN_NONE; +} + +static char *acquireprogress_fail_doc = "fail(item: AcquireItemDesc)\n\n" + "Invoked when the process of fetching an item encounters a fatal error."; +static PyObject *acquireprogress_fail(PyObject *self, PyObject *args) +{ + // TODO: Add type check. + Py_RETURN_NONE; +} + +static char *acquireprogress_pulse_doc = "pulse(owner: Acquire) -> bool\n\n" + "Periodically invoked while the Acquire process is underway.\n\n" + "Return False if the user asked to cancel the whole Acquire process."; +static PyObject *acquireprogress_pulse(PyObject *self, PyObject *args) +{ + // TODO: Add type check. + Py_RETURN_TRUE; +} + +static char *acquireprogress_start_doc = "start()\n\n" + "Invoked when the Acquire process starts running."; +static PyObject *acquireprogress_start(PyObject *self, PyObject *args) +{ + Py_RETURN_NONE; +} + +static char *acquireprogress_stop_doc = "stop()\n\n" + "Invoked when the Acquire process stops running."; +static PyObject *acquireprogress_stop(PyObject *self, PyObject *args) +{ + Py_RETURN_NONE; +} + +static PyMethodDef acquireprogress_methods[] = { + {"media_change", acquireprogress_media_change, METH_VARARGS, + acquireprogress_media_change_doc}, + {"ims_hit",acquireprogress_ims_hit,METH_VARARGS, + acquireprogress_ims_hit_doc}, + {"fetch",acquireprogress_fetch,METH_VARARGS,acquireprogress_fetch_doc}, + {"done",acquireprogress_done,METH_VARARGS,acquireprogress_done_doc}, + {"fail",acquireprogress_fail,METH_VARARGS,acquireprogress_fail_doc}, + {"pulse",acquireprogress_pulse,METH_VARARGS,acquireprogress_pulse_doc}, + {"start",acquireprogress_start,METH_NOARGS,acquireprogress_start_doc}, + {"stop",acquireprogress_stop,METH_NOARGS,acquireprogress_stop_doc}, + {NULL} +}; + +static PyMemberDef acquireprogress_members[] = { + {"last_bytes", T_DOUBLE, offsetof(PyAcquireProgressObject, last_bytes), 0, + "The number of bytes fetched as of the previous call to pulse(),\n" + "including local items."}, + {"current_cps", T_DOUBLE, offsetof(PyAcquireProgressObject, current_cps), 0, + "The current rate of download, in bytes per second."}, + {"current_bytes", T_DOUBLE, offsetof(PyAcquireProgressObject, current_bytes), + 0, "The number of bytes fetched."}, + {"total_bytes", T_DOUBLE, offsetof(PyAcquireProgressObject, total_bytes), 0, + "The total number of bytes that need to be fetched. This member is\n" + "inaccurate, as new items might be enqueued while the download is\n" + "in progress!"}, + {"fetched_bytes", T_DOUBLE,offsetof(PyAcquireProgressObject, fetched_bytes), + 0, "The total number of bytes accounted for by items that were\n" + "successfully fetched."}, + {"elapsed_time", T_ULONG, offsetof(PyAcquireProgressObject, elapsed_time),0, + "The amount of time that has elapsed since the download started."}, + {"total_items", T_ULONG, offsetof(PyAcquireProgressObject, total_items),0, + "The total number of items that need to be fetched. This member is\n" + "inaccurate, as new items might be enqueued while the download is\n" + "in progress!"}, + {"current_items", T_ULONG, offsetof(PyAcquireProgressObject, current_items), + 0, "The number of items that have been successfully downloaded."}, + {NULL} +}; + +static char *acquireprogress_doc = "AcquireProgress()\n\n" + "A monitor object for downloads controlled by the Acquire class. This is\n" + "an mostly abstract class. You should subclass it and implement the\n" + "methods to get something useful."; + +PyTypeObject PyAcquireProgress_Type = { + PyVarObject_HEAD_INIT(&PyType_Type, 0) + "apt_pkg.AcquireProgress", // tp_name + sizeof(PyAcquireProgressObject), // tp_basicsize + 0, // tp_itemsize + // Methods + 0, // tp_dealloc + 0, // tp_print + 0, // tp_getattr + 0, // tp_setattr + 0, // tp_compare + 0, // tp_repr + 0, // tp_as_number + 0, // tp_as_sequence + 0, // tp_as_mapping + 0, // tp_hash + 0, // tp_call + 0, // tp_str + 0, // tp_getattro + 0, // tp_setattro + 0, // tp_as_buffer + Py_TPFLAGS_DEFAULT | // tp_flags + Py_TPFLAGS_BASETYPE, + acquireprogress_doc, // tp_doc + 0, // tp_traverse + 0, // tp_clear + 0, // tp_richcompare + 0, // tp_weaklistoffset + 0, // tp_iter + 0, // tp_iternext + acquireprogress_methods, // tp_methods + acquireprogress_members, // tp_members + 0, // tp_getset + 0, // tp_base + 0, // tp_dict + 0, // tp_descr_get + 0, // tp_descr_set + 0, // tp_dictoffset + 0, // tp_init + 0, // tp_alloc + PyType_GenericNew, // tp_new +}; |
